    Description
    As an Esthetician, you offer resort guests an opportunity to connect with the solitude of the valley and culture of Taos within the comfort of a serene spa. You pay attention to detail and ensure you put a personal touch that says every guest is special. You have the knowledge and ability to perform facials and body services that meet the guidelines and expectations as laid out by the Spa Manager as well as within the guidelines established by your current licensure within the State of New Mexico. You maintain the highest level of product knowledge and have a complete understanding of all spa services offered. You know the ingredients in products and can explain their benefits to guests and help answer any guest questions in a positive and professional manner.

    As Blake Hotel staff you are knowledgeable about Taos Ski Valley, The Blake Hotel and The Spa and able to provide direction to guests to include packages offered, hours of operation, class schedules of The Spa & Fitness Center, mountain statistics and the adventurous offerings of our scenic surroundings. You try to remember unique things about each guest experience and reach out to them post-visit. You are responsible for cleanliness in your designated treatment room and follow checklists to ensure room cleanliness between each guest as well as at the end of your shift.

    Essential Job Responsibilities:
    • Adheres to policies of Taos Ski Valley, Inc.
    • Performs facials and body services that adhere to the established treatment protocols while fulfilling guest's unique expectations.
    • Performs all treatments on services menu based upon current licensure.
    • Assesses contraindications of guest that may require modification of the service or prevent the service from taking place.
    • Meets guests' needs through engaging in active listening from guest pick-up to drop-off.
    • Cleans and disinfects all equipment and treatment room daily.
    • Recommends products and after-care for at-home support.
    • Suggests other beneficial treatments offered in the spa.
    • Begins and ends all treatments on time.
    • Works assigned schedule and arrives and departs from shift on time.
    • Ensures that work areas are clean and set according to procedures
    • Informs Spa Director/Manager or other management personnel about product and or maintenance needs.
    • Attends all scheduled meetings
    • Attends scheduled professional trainings.
    • Reports any incidents or accidents to a member of the management team.
    • Other duties as assigned
    Personal Skills:
    • Strong personal character and commitment to Taos Ski Valley, Inc.'s Vision, Purpose, and Values.
    • Provides a guest experience that exceeds the guest's expectations.
    • Ability to gracefully and humbly accept criticism and opportunities for growth.
    • Ability to stay positive, focused, and constructive when faced with setbacks, challenges, and while working in an ever-changing environment.
    • Ability to build positive rapport with the guests through personable interactions.
    • Willingness to learn and ask for help and/or clarification.
    Qualifications/Knowledge:
    • High School Diploma or GED preferred
    • Current & Valid New Mexico License in Esthetics
    • Customer service experience, preferably in a spa and or salon
    • Growing knowledge of spa treatments/services and skincare technologies and tools
    • Literacy in skin types, widely used skincare ingredients and chemicals, as well as skin conditions and medications effecting and or used for the skin
    • Ability to explain various treatments/services and educate guests on skin health and at-home skin care
    • Must be able to manage time, maintain an organized workspace, and be able to handle a variety of duties simultaneously.
    • Must have a professional manner, use discretion with guests and other staff, and have a polished appearance while working.
    • Demonstrates comfort level in product knowledge and product recommendation.
    • Ability to work a flexible schedule including weekends, holidays, and evenings.
    Work Environment:

    Taos Ski Valley, Inc. is often a fast-paced work environment, especially during Holiday and Peak days. TSVI is located in a high-altitude alpine environment. Position may require travel on uneven, snow-packed, or icy terrain and may be exposed to wet, cold, and/or humid conditions. Must be able to work in close quarters with spa guests and other staff. Work conditions will include exposure to a variety of odors and smells as well as different cleaning supplies and skincare products.

    Physical Demands of Position Include:

    The Licensed Esthetician position requires you to lift up to 25 pounds on a frequent basis and occasionally group lift up to 50 pounds. This position requires you to be able to talk, hear, smell, stand and walk 80-90% of the time and to sit, stoop, kneel, crouch, bend 10-20% of the time.

    This position will require you to clean floors, surfaces and spa machinery like a high frequency device, steamer, hot towel cabinet and electric treatment tables. You will be asked to work with and apply a variety of skincare products and ingredients to meet different guest needs and treatment protocols. You will spend about 5% of the job on the computer and cellular phone navigating scheduling software and human resources software.
